What do Music Performance Students Learn?


Music students majoring in performance focus on the practical aspects of musicianship, participating in a wide variety of musical settings, from small ensembles to full orchestras. They receive coaching and private lessons from tutors, professors and guest musicians in order to improve their skills, and study performance styles, musicianship and the business of music. However, students also take courses in other aspects of music, such as theory, history and composition; to round out their degrees, they take electives in the liberal arts and sciences, or in other fine arts. Students usually specialize in a particular family of instruments (such as percussion) or a style of music (such as church music or jazz). Some programs encourage students to learn aspects of the film, video or theatre industry that relate to the production of music.
